2026 MINI Countryman vs 2026 Toyota Grand Highlander Hybrid
Comparison Overview
The 2026 MINI Countryman bursts onto the scene with sharp handling and distinctive British flair, delivering a punchy 241 hp from its compact 175.0-inch frame, making tight city maneuvering a joy. Contrasting this energetic posture is the massive 2026 Toyota Grand Highlander Hybrid, prioritizing cavernous space and efficiency, boasting an impressive 34 combined MPG powered by 245 hp. The MINI, though shorter and prioritizing sportiness, requires the recommended premium unleaded fuel, while the Toyota runs happily on regular. The price gap is significant; the Countryman starts at $38,900 compared to the Toyota's $44,710, meaning the Toyota asks a $5,810 premium. However, the Toyota counters this with a substantial 7 MPG advantage in combined driving, offering a strong argument for long-term running cost savings over the smaller, but thrilling, Countryman.

Choose the MINI Countryman if...
- You crave an agile driving feel and do not need the three-row capacity of the much longer 201.4-inch Toyota.
- You prioritize a lower initial purchase price, starting at $38,900.
- You prefer the more direct feel of a 7-speed automated manual transmission over a CVT.
Choose the Toyota Grand Highlander Hybrid if...
- Maximum fuel economy is paramount, given the 34 combined MPG versus the Countryman's 27.
- You absolutely require a larger footprint, as the Toyota measures 78.3 inches wide compared to the MINI's 72.6 inches.
- You prefer using regular unleaded fuel instead of the Countryman's recommended premium fuel.

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about comparing the 2026 MINI Countryman and 2026 Toyota Grand Highlander Hybrid.
How much larger is the Toyota Grand Highlander Hybrid compared to the MINI Countryman?
The Toyota is significantly larger; its length is 201.4 inches while the MINI Countryman measures only 175.0 inches. This size difference extends to height, where the Toyota stands at 72.1 inches against the MINI's 65.2 inches.
Is the performance between these two vehicles vastly different?
The performance figures are quite close on paper, with the Toyota producing 245 hp and the MINI delivering 241 hp. However, the MINI offers 295 lb-ft of torque, potentially giving it a slight edge in immediate responsiveness despite both utilizing AWD.
Which vehicle is more expensive to purchase upfront?
The 2026 Toyota Grand Highlander Hybrid carries a higher MSRP of $44,710, resulting in a direct price difference of $5,810 when compared to the 2026 MINI Countryman's $38,900 starting price.
What is the primary reason the Toyota is better for long road trips?
The Toyota's superior fuel efficiency, achieving 34 combined MPG on regular unleaded, strongly outweighs the Countryman's 27 combined MPG, saving money over long distances.
